Kako pronaći znak u nizu s desne strane u Excelu (4 jednostavne metode)

  • Podijeli Ovo
Hugh West

Članak će opisati postupak za pronalaženje znakova u nizu desno u Excelu. Ponekad moramo pohraniti posljednje podatke znakovnog niza u Excelu. Pretpostavimo da želimo pohraniti prezimena određene skupine ljudi u stupac. U tom slučaju, trebamo izdvojiti znakove u imenu s desne strane.

Ovdje ću koristiti sljedeći skup podataka za opisivanje taktike pronalaženja znakova u nizu s desne strane. Pretpostavimo da grupa ljudi radi u uredu i imaju svoj vlastiti ID i Korisnički ID . Radit ćemo na njihovim Imenima , ID-u i Korisničkom ID-u kako bismo objasnili naš problem i njegovo rješenje.

Preuzmite radnu bilježnicu za vježbe

Pronađi znak s desne strane.xlsx

4 načina za pronalaženje znaka u nizu s desne strane u Excelu

1. Korištenje funkcije Excel RIGHT za pronalaženje znaka u nizu s desna

Najjednostavniji način za pronalaženje znakova u nizu s desna je korištenje funkcije RIGHT . Pretpostavimo da želimo pohraniti brojeve u ID u stupcu . Razgovarajmo o strategiji u nastavku.

Koraci:

  • Prvo napravite novi stupac i upišite sljedeću formulu u ćeliju E5 .
=RIGHT(C5,3)

Ovdje, DESNO funkcija uzima niz znakova u ćeliji C5 i pronalazi zadnja 3 znaka iz njega. Kao svaki ID ima 3 broja, stavljamo [num_chars] kao 3 .

  • Pritisnite ENTER i vidjet ćete posljednje 3 znamenke ID-a u ćeliji C5 .

  • Sada upotrijebite Ručku za popunjavanje za Automatsko popunjavanje nižih ćelija.

Ova će operacija pružiti vas s brojevima u ID u stupcu E . Tako možete pronaći znakove u nizu s desne strane i pohraniti ih u ćeliju.

Pročitajte više: Kako pronaći znak u nizu Excel (8 jednostavnih načina)

2. Primjena funkcija Excel LEN i FIND za izdvajanje znakova u nizu s desne strane

Pretpostavimo da želimo izdvojiti prezimena iz imena . Možemo slijediti trikove ispod.

Koraci:

  • Napravite novi stupac za prezimena i upišite sljedeća formula u ćeliji E5 .
=RIGHT(B5,LEN(B5)-FIND(" ",B5))

Ovdje identificiramo položaj Razmaka između imena imena i prezimena uz pomoć FIND funkcije i zatim oduzmite ovu poziciju od duljine niza u ćeliji B5 (cijelo ime ). Na ovaj način kažemo funkciji RIGHT koje znakove treba pohraniti u ćeliju E5 . Koristili smo funkciju LEN za određivanje duljine niza ćelije B5 .

  • Sada pritisnite gumb ENTER i vidjet će prezime ćelije B5 u ćeliji E5 .

  • Koristite Ručku za popunjavanje za AutoFill niže ćelije.

Nakon toga, vidjet ćete prezimena u stupcu E . Ovo je još jedna metoda koju možete primijeniti da pronađete znakove u nizu s desne strane i pohranite ih u ćeliju.

Pročitajte više: Kako pronaći s desne strane u Excelu ( 6 Metoda)

Slična očitanja

  • [Popravljeno]: Ne mogu pronaći pogrešku projekta ili biblioteke u programu Excel (3 rješenja)
  • Kako pronaći * znak koji nije zamjenski znak u Excelu (2 metode)
  • Kako pronaći zadnji redak s određenom vrijednošću u Excelu ( 6 metoda)
  • Pronađi zadnju vrijednost u stupcu većem od nule u Excelu (2 jednostavne formule)
  • Kako pronaći najmanje 3 vrijednosti u Excelu (5 jednostavnih metoda)

3. Korištenje kombiniranih funkcija za pronalaženje znaka u nizu s desne strane

Zamislite da samo želite pohraniti broj iz Korisničkog ID-a ovih momaka. To možemo učiniti ugniježđivanjem funkcija LEN , FIND i SUBSTITUTE u funkciju RIGHT . Pogledajmo kako možemo ispuniti našu svrhu.

Koraci:

  • Napravite novi stupac za Korisnički ID broj i upišite sljedeću formulu u ćeliju E5 .
=RIGHT(D5,LEN(D5)-FIND("#",SUBSTITUTE(D5,"-","#",LEN(D5)-LEN(SUBSTITUTE(D5,"-","")))))

Ovdje, ugniježdili smo LEN , FIND i SUBSTITUTE u RIGHT funkciju kako bismo izdvojili UID broj kaotekst. Rastavimo formulu na dijelove u nastavku.

Razdvajanje formule

  • LEN(D5)—-> Funkcija Length vraća broj znakova .
    • Izlaz : 11
  • ZAMJENA(D5,”-“,””)—-> ; Funkcija SUBSTITUTE ničim ne zamjenjuje crtice .
  • SUBSTITUTE(“PLK-OIQ-249″,”-“,”” )—-> postaje PLKOIQ249
    • Izlaz: “PLKOIQ249”
  • LEN(ZAMJENA(D5,”-“,””))—-> postaje LEN( “PLKOIQ249” )
    • Izlaz: 9
  • LEN(D5)-LEN(ZAMJENA(D5,”-“,””))) —-> postaje LEN(D5)-LEN( “PLKOIQ249” )
    • 11-9
    • Izlaz : 2
  • ZAMJENA(D5,”-“,”#”,LEN(D5)-LEN(ZAMJENA(D5,” -“,””))—-> postaje
  • ZAMJENA(D5,”-“,”#”,2)—> Zamjenjuje 2. crtica '-' s hashtagom '#')
    • Izlaz: “PLK-OIQ#249”
  • FIND(“#”,ZAMJENA(D5,”-“,”#”,LEN(D5)-LEN(ZAMJENA(D5,”-“ ,””))))—-> postaje
  • FIND(“#”,”PLK-OIQ#249″)—-> NALAZ funkcija pronalazi poziciju za dati znak # .
    • Izlaz : 8
  • DESNO(D5,LEN(D5)-NAĐI(“#” ,ZAMJENA(D5,”-“,”#”,LEN(D5)-LEN(ZAMJENA(D5,”-“,””)))))—-> okreće seu
  • DESNO(D5,LEN(D5)-8)—->
  • DESNO(D5,11-8)—->
  • DESNO(D5,3)—->
  • DESNO(“PLK-OIQ-249”,3)—-> Funkcija DESNO izdvaja broj znakova s ​​ desne strane .
    • Izlaz: 249

Konačno, dobivamo ID korisnika 249 . Idemo opet na korake .

  • Pritisnite ENTER i vidjet ćete samo broj u Korisničkom ID-u .

  • Nakon toga upotrijebite ručicu za popunjavanje za automatsko popunjavanje nižih ćelija.

Tako možete smjestiti brojeve u Korisnički ID u stupcu E . Malo je teško pronaći znakove u nizu s njegove desne strane kada se pojavi ovakva situacija.

Pročitajte više: Kako pronaći znak u nizu u Excelu

4. Pronalaženje znakova u nizu s desne strane pomoću Flash Filla

Ako niste tip za formule, možete upotrijebiti naredbu Flash Fill za pronalaženje znakova u nizu s njegove desne strane. Recimo da želite pohraniti prezimena tih ljudi. Razgovarajmo o ovom jednostavnom procesu.

Koraci:

  • Napravite novi stupac za prezimena i upišite prezime ( Spears ) u ćeliji B5 .
  • Odaberite Home >> Ispuni >> Flash Fill

Ovdje naredba Flash Fill slijedi obrazac. Todetektira niz znakova Spears kao znakove s desne strane cijelog niza u ćeliji B5 . I tako će učiniti isto za ostale ćelije.

  • Ova operacija će vratiti sva prezimena u preostalim ćelijama E6 do E11 .

Tako možete pronaći znakove u nizu s njegove desne pozicije.

Pročitajte više: Excel funkcija: FIND vs SEARCH (Komparativna analiza)

Odjeljak za vježbu

Ovdje vam dajem skup podataka koji smo upotrijebili da objasnimo kako pronaći znakove u nizu s pravog položaja tako da možete sami vježbati.

Zaključak

Članak je pružio neke metode kako pronaći znakove u nizu iz pravo. Metode koje sam ovdje opisao prilično su jednostavne za razumijevanje. Nadam se da će vam ovo pomoći da riješite svoje probleme u vezi s tim. Ako imate učinkovitije metode ili ideje ili bilo kakve povratne informacije, ostavite ih u polju za komentare. To bi mi moglo pomoći da obogatim svoje nadolazeće članke.

Hugh West vrlo je iskusan Excel trener i analitičar s više od 10 godina iskustva u industriji. Diplomirao je računovodstvo i financije te magistrirao poslovno upravljanje. Hugh ima strast za podučavanjem i razvio je jedinstveni pristup podučavanju koji je lako pratiti i razumjeti. Njegovo stručno poznavanje programa Excel pomoglo je tisućama studenata i profesionalaca diljem svijeta da poboljšaju svoje vještine i postignu uspjeh u karijeri. Putem svog bloga, Hugh dijeli svoje znanje sa svijetom, nudeći besplatne vodiče za Excel i online obuku kako bi pomogao pojedincima i tvrtkama da dostignu svoj puni potencijal.